This storage jar, of unknown date, was made by an anonymous artist. The vessel presents a rounded body, its surface covered in horizontal striations that evoke a sense of rhythmic texture. These lines create a tactile quality, inviting the viewer to trace their path around the jar’s form. The darker bands of pigment, contrasting with the lighter clay, introduce a visual structure that segments the surface and accentuates its volume.
